    ABOUT THE JOB

    Busy boutique estate planning and estate administration law firm located in Northwest DC has an immediate opening for a full-time Trust & Estates Legal Assistant.

    RESPONSIBILITIES:

    -        Receive, open, log, and scan all incoming mail

    -        Sort and distribute incoming mail

    -        Prepare binders that organize a clients’ signed estate planning documents

    -        Scan, save and appropriately store client documents

    -        Provide administrative support to attorneys by scheduling meetings, answering phones, and sending meeting reminders to clients

    -        Welcome clients and other visitors

    -        Draft client correspondence

    -        Prepare and assemble large mailings with multiple enclosures

    -        Assemble estate planning documents in preparation for signing

    -        Prepare and submit beneficiary designation forms for life insurance and retirement accounts

    -        Form limited liability companies in various states and draft simple operating agreements

    -        Assist in drafting Wills, powers of attorney, purchase agreements, promissory notes and other legal documents

    -        Assist in preparing flow charts to provide a visual summary of an estate plan or transaction 

    -        Obtain and record tax ID numbers for trusts 

    -        Assist in tracking completion of various components of transactions and keeping all involved attorneys and paralegals updated on  project status
